How To Fix CNV790 - Duplicate processing type for table &1 was not maintained


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CNV - Conversion: Messages for Conversion Services (CNCC)

  • Message number: 790

  • Message text: Duplicate processing type for table &1 was not maintained

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    A key field of table &V1& is converted.
    However the duplicate processing type indicator for this table has not
    been maintained.

    System Response

    If you have a merge scenario, duplicate records may occur while this
    table is being converted. If the duplicate processing type is not set
    and duplicate records occur, the conversion program terminates.

    How to fix this error?

    If necessary, maintain the duplicate processing type for the
    corresponding table in activity <ZK>Settings for new conversion-Relevant
    tables and Fields</>.
    &TECHNICAL-INFO&
    Duplicate handling type is stored in column SUMUP of table CNVTABLES.
    For available values see corresponding <DS:DE.CNV_SUM>F1-help document
    </>.
